301 Redirects

301 redirects for Shopify help you make changes in your site without interrupting your customers. You can utilize this service to upgrade search engines, redirect broken links and redirect visitors to new pages.

Shopify immediately develops redirects when you alter the manage of a URL or component in your website. The URL Redirects menu in the navigation permits you to edit, add, and delete redirects. You can likewise export or import redirects. You can submit hundreds of redirects at once utilizing the Shopify import tool. It’s easy to use and has a basic format for including redirects.

Redirects help you keep a constant backlink profile, prevent users from seeing a 404 page, and ensure a smooth shopping experience. You can also use redirects to redirect visitors to a page that is no longer as much as date.

301 redirects are the most common kind of redirect. You can create a 301 redirect by guaranteeing that the “from” and “to” courses are the same. You can likewise use relative courses to reroute to a page off of Shopify.

Utilizing a 301 redirect is a fantastic way to keep domain authority and search ranking. You can also redirect users who have conserved old URLs in their web browser bookmarks. The internet browser cache is more likely to follow redirects, even if you change the URL.

Shopify has an easy tool to include redirects wholesale. You can import a CSV file and upload hundreds of redirects at the same time. It’s easy to use and needs you to input the correct data.

Shopify likewise permits you to manually add redirects to your site. You can do this from the Online Store navigation. You can access this service by clicking the red button in the upper right corner of the navigation. You can also edit or erase redirects from the 301-Redirect record.

Abandoned Cart Recovery

Using the right Shopify abandoned cart recovery app can automate your recovery projects. This will help you convert more visitors into buyers. You will need to discover the right app for your specific business requirements. These apps will differ in regards to features and rate.

One of the most crucial things you can do to recover abandoned carts is provide customers with rewards. Rewards like free shipping can help motivate consumers to finish their purchases. You can provide complimentary shipping for carts with qualifying products, or even supply a small discount code. These incentive offers can push visitors over the edge and motivate them to complete their purchases.

Another method to recover abandoned carts is to use virtual customer care. This is a service that is readily available on lots of e-commerce platforms. You can use this service to provide customers with a virtual assistant who can assist them with making their choice. You can even use it to provide vouchers and recommendations to customers who have left your site.

Another method to recuperate abandoned carts from customers is through a series of push notifications. There are a few apps on the market, such as PushOwl and Omnisend, which can automate sending notifications to customers. These alerts can be utilized to advise shoppers of items they’ve currently bought. You can also utilize them to inform consumers about price drops or shipping suggestions.

The most popular method to recuperate abandoned carts is through email campaigns. These e-mails need to include a clear call to action, as well as social evidence and an incentive to finish the purchase. You ought to also provide a free shipping offer in your email.

Other ways to recuperate abandoned carts include using a chatbot or pop-up. These messages can be branded and mobile-optimized.
